c exponential growth //example population growthdP/dt = lambda*P
c e.g. lambda ~ 1 /years lambda ~ 1 /time
real lambda / .02 /
kount=5
kprint=kount
p0=1.
tscale=1./lambda
dt=tscale/100.
tf=2.*tscale
nstep=int(tf/dt)
print 100 , 0., p0
do 10 i=1,nstep
t=dt*float(i)
p1=p0+dt*lambda*p0
if(i.eq.kprint)then
print 100 , t , p1
kprint=kprint + kount
endif
p0=p1
10 continue
100 format(2x,'t,Poblacion(Billones)=',2(4x,e11.4))
stop
end
